Paris — July 2026. The second WLTD Entertainment writing camp ran this month, five months after the first.
What changed
Everything the February camp taught, and the weather.
The first camp was an experiment with a format. The second was run by people who had already done it once and knew which parts to keep — longer sessions, fewer rooms, and no attempt to schedule the collisions that had produced the best work last time. You cannot timetable those. You can only leave enough unstructured hours for them to happen in.
July in Paris
The city empties in July, which makes it an unusually good place to work. Everyone who is still here is here on purpose. Sessions ran late because there was no reason for them not to, and the building stayed warm long after anyone sensible had gone home.
The same two people in the middle
Simon Rosenfeld and Myla are both working songwriters as well as recording artists, and both write in the room rather than supervising it. That is the part outside participants tend to comment on — the label's own writers are not hosting, they are working.
Twice a year, for now
Two camps in one year was not a plan so much as a consequence: the first one produced enough to make the second obvious. Whether that becomes a rhythm depends on what this one turns into over the next few months.
